Output e2084860eed2a23f91abe3bb0a03be6006d6f7c7fa31ee116675eb965f8eb56f:116

value
39006
script pubkey
OP_0 OP_PUSHBYTES_20 ec80a181609a52737abaa3fcf0b5af02b379d916
address
bc1qajq2rqtqnff8x7465070pdd0q2ehnkgkfpug2v
transaction
e2084860eed2a23f91abe3bb0a03be6006d6f7c7fa31ee116675eb965f8eb56f
confirmations
87927
spent
true